Transaction 731ca0486cdb4878e69f645b31370b364158b030c412212b6f050dd182aa8206
1 Input
2 Outputs
- 731ca0486cdb4878e69f645b31370b364158b030c412212b6f050dd182aa8206:0
- 731ca0486cdb4878e69f645b31370b364158b030c412212b6f050dd182aa8206:1
value 475008
address 32eM4pC6EmwgjbczhhDgCALZyCjvYQ2EPm
value 617425
address 18jSJZH43SqPamS3gSRZVCUkCXdeDhUbGK